Recommended amounts and types

The World Cancer Research Fund and American Institute of Cancer Research emphasize eating mostly foods of plant origin, including non-starchy vegetables, fruits and legumes, all of which contain substantial amounts of dietary fiber, micronutrients and are low in energy density, making them an important part of weight management.
